有人可以给一个非常简单的c++ 11例子信号槽连接在Qt 5使用新的语法与函数指针信号/槽函数需要超过3个参数?这是我的理解,如果信号/槽函数有超过3个参数,如果使用c++ 98编译失败,沿着一行错误:
/Users/xxxx/Qt5.0.1/5.0.1/clang_64/include/QtCore/qobject_impl.h:82: error:数组初始化项中元素过多QtPrivate::QMetaTypeIdHelper::qt_metatype_id(), QtPrivate::QMetaTypeIdHelper::qt_metatype_id(), 0};返回t;}};^
为了答案的完整性和每个人的利益,也很高兴看到一个重载信号连接到超过3个参数的插槽,同样使用c++ 11。
谢谢!
这是Qt的一个bug,现在已经修复了。